Should be able to `return' and `break' from callback method of plain DL?

Description

IRCで笹田さんと話をしていて発見したのですが、fiddleありだと
DLのコールバックメソッドからreturnやbreakが可能ですが、なしだと
LocalJumpErrorが発生します。

私の見解としては、returnできた方がうれしい気がしています。
が、いずれにせよ、挙動を揃えた方がいいのではないかと思います。
どう思いますか?>Aaronさん

以下、素のDLでもreturnできるようにするパッチです。

Index: ext/dl/lib/dl/func.rb

--- ext/dl/lib/dl/func.rb (リビジョン 35505)
+++ ext/dl/lib/dl/func.rb (作業コピー)
@@ -90,6 +90,9 @@ module DL
if( !block )
raise(RuntimeError, "block must be given.")
end

  •    unless block.lambda?
    
  •      block = Class.new{define_method(:call, block)}.new.method(:call)
    
  •    end
       if( @cfunc.ptr == 0 )
         cb = Proc.new{|*args|
           ary = @stack.unpack(args)

  • ext/dl/lib/dl/func.rb (DL::Function#bind): allow to return/break from
    the callback method. (Fiddle already allows it.)
    [Bug #6389] [ruby-dev:45604]
